[R] Declaring variables in R

Thomas Lumley tlumley at u.washington.edu
Fri Oct 19 17:52:50 CEST 2007


On Thu, 18 Oct 2007, Moshe Olshansky wrote:

> Please forgive me if my question is answered in Help
> FAQ no. 23481739...

If it were, we might well not forgive you -- the faq isn't *that* long. But it isn't.

> In VBA one can use a special statement (Option
> Explicit) which does not allow using variables which
> have not been previously declared. As far as I
> remember this can also be done in Matlab (or at least
> there is a utility which can check whether your
> program uses undeclared variables).
>
> My question is: does such an option/utility exist in
> R?
>

The codetools package provides a tool that scans your code for undeclared variables.  It is not perfect --- it has occasional false positives and false negatives -- but it is pretty good.

      -thomas

Thomas Lumley			Assoc. Professor, Biostatistics
tlumley at u.washington.edu	University of Washington, Seattle



More information about the R-help mailing list